AUTOPILOT/STICK PUSHER DISCONNECT SWITCH
When pressed, disengages the autopilot and
disables the stick pusher system.
FRONT VIEW
PITCH TRIM DISCONNECT SWITCH
When pressed, disengages the autopilot
and pitch trim system.
TOUCH CONTROL STEERING SWITCH
When pressed, disconnects the autopilot servo clutches to allow
manual flight path commands to be inserted without disengaging
the autopilot and coupled flight director mode.

(11) Indicated Airspeed Hold Mode
The indicated airspeed hold mode is selected by pressing the IAS
switch/light on the flight director mode selector. When IAS is
selected, it overrides the APR CAP, GA, ALT, VS, MACH, ALTSEL CAP or
PITCH HOLD modes. VRT is annunciated on the ADI. In the IAS mode,
the pitch command is proportional to airspeed error provided by the
air data computer. Pressing and holding the TCS button allows the
pilot to manoeuvre the aircraft to a new airspeed hold reference
without disengaging the mode. Once engaged in the IAS mode, the mode
resets if the air data computer is not valid and the ADI command cue
goes out of view if the vertical gyro is not valid.
(12) Vertical Speed Hold Mode
The vertical speed hold mode is selected by pressing the VS
switch/light on the flight director mode selector. When VS is
selected, it overrides the APR CAP, GA, ALT, ALTSEL CAP, IAS, MACH or
PITCH HOLD modes. VRT is annunciated on the ADI. Pressing and
holding the TCS button allows the pilot to manoeuvre the aircraft to a
new vertical speed hold reference without disengaging the mode. Once
engaged in the VS mode, the mode resets if the air data computer is
not valid and the ADI command cue goes out of view if the vertical
gyro is not valid.
(13) Mach Hold Mode
The Mach hold mode is selected by pressing the MACH switch/light on
the flight director mode selector. When the Mach hold mode is
selected, it overrides the APR CAP, GA, ALTSEL CAP or PITCH SYNC
modes. VRT is annunciated on the ADI. In the Mach hold mode, the
pitch command is proportional to the Mach provided by the air data
computer. Pressing and holding the TCS button allows the pilot to
manoeuvre the aircraft to a new Mach hold reference without
disengaging the mode. Once engaged in the Mach hold mode, the mode
resets if the air data computer is not valid and the ADI command cue
goes out of view if the vertical gyro is not valid.
(14) Standby Mode
The standby mode is selected by pressing the SBY switch/light on the
flight director mode selector. This resets all other flight director
modes and biases the ADI command cue from view. While pressed, the
SBY switch/light acts as a lamp test. All mode annunciators come on
and the flight director warning flag (FD) comes into view. When the
switch/light is released, all mode annunciators go out and the FD
warning flag retracts from view.
